PHOENIX — Vice President Mike Pence will visit Arizona next week, the White House announced Tuesday.

Pence will arrive in Arizona on Aug. 11 to visit organizations in Tucson and Mesa.

In Tucson, Pence will be endorsed by the Arizona Association of Police, which represents 47 agencies in the state.

He will then go to Mesa for an event with the Latter-day Saints for Trump Coalition.

Pence last visited Arizona on July 1, when he met with Gov. Doug Ducey in Phoenix to discuss the state’s effort to stop the spread of coronavirus.

The vice president originally planned to attend a campaign event in Tucson on his last visit, but that was called off amid a rise in coronavirus cases.

Ducey is going to Washington, D.C. on Wednesday to discuss efforts in fighting coronavirus and helping the economy.
